Considering the three branches that make up the Federal Reserve System, identify the corresponding branches that make up the Euro system. Be sure to state which part of the Euro system corresponds to which part of the Federal Reserve System.
What will be an ideal response?
The Euro system has a six member Executive Board, which would resemble the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System. The National Central Banks of the Euro system would resemble the twelve Regional Banks of the Federal Reserve System. The Governing Council of the Euro system, which is made up of the Executive Council and the governors of the central banks in the euro area, resembles the Federal Reserve's Federal Open Market Committee.
